☐ Hardware lab access (Floor 3, Fenmore Building). Walk the new starter to the lab entrance beside the east stairwell and point out the emergency stop panel and the anti-static mat requirement before they step inside. Confirm their photo badge has printed correctly and that their name matches the Draybourne onboarding list; if it doesn't, hold them at reception and call the lab steward. Once confirmed, they will need the temporary door code, which is the following.

turnstile pass: bdg-JVSWH-52711

TICKET VELLUM-2841: Split user module out of the Corvane monolith. The user module currently owns auth, profiles, and notification prefs; we're extracting it into a standalone service behind the Harlow gateway. Scope for this ticket: carve out the profile endpoints only, keep auth in place. Since you're new to the codebase, start with the module map in docs/architecture. When you cut your first branch, record the trace token below.

pipeline stamp: htk31_f769b577b3028a4e9958e5bb8d1259a

Welcome aboard. The Hollowbeam agents compress telemetry payloads with a dictionary-based scheme before shipping to the collector. For your security review: dictionaries are rotated weekly, payloads are compressed before encryption (we accepted the residual size-leak risk in last quarter's assessment), and decompression is bounded at 8 MB to prevent expansion attacks. Alerts fire if ratios drop suddenly, which usually means a malformed dictionary. The threat model and rotation procedure are documented here.

operations page: https://jenkins.zemvarcloud.local/job/merge_requests/repo/build/73930b4b30f0a8ed

CHANGELOG — Ledgerfox 3.2: changed defaults on the tax-rate lookup cache. TTL dropped from 24h to 1h so stale jurisdiction rates can't linger after a rate change, and negative-result caching is now off by default (it was masking lookup failures as zero-rate). Heads up for security review: cache entries are now signed before storage. The new default cache configuration ships as follows.

config for kafof-bawef:
holath:
  log_level: debug
  metrics_host: metrics.holath.qorvelsys.internal
  pin: 2191
  pool_size: 32